Understanding Sensory Sensitivities and SleepFor many individuals with autism spectrum disorder (ASD) or sensory processing disorder (SPD), bedtime can be a significant challenge. Sensory sensitivities — whether to texture, temperature, pressure, or sound — can make it difficult to fall asleep and stay asleep, affecting wellbeing for both the individual and their family or carers.The right bedding can make a meaningful difference.
